About 1 Alma Cottages
1 Alma Cottages is a two-bedroom end-of-terrace house in Ludham, Great Yarmouth, Great Yarmouth (NR29 5QB). It has a recorded floor area of 54 m² (around 581 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(July 2018) shows a D (score 56), a step below the typical UK home. When first surveyed in March 2010 the rating was F, the property has climbed 2 bands since.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Very Poor to Good, window efficiency went from Average to Good and lighting went from Very Poor to Very Good; while hot-water efficiency dropped from Poor to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 80). Main heating runs on wood logs. Period features are noted in the property record.
Across 1996–2014, sale prices on this property compounded at 7.2%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£176,000 sits 66.8% above the 2014 sale of £105,500. 12 years since the last transfer (July 2014).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property.
